Real-time multitarget tracking for sensor-based sortingA new implementation of the auction algorithm for graphics processing units

被引:0
|
作者
Georg Maier
Florian Pfaff
Matthias Wagner
Christoph Pieper
Robin Gruna
Benjamin Noack
Harald Kruggel-Emden
Thomas Längle
Uwe D. Hanebeck
Siegmar Wirtz
Viktor Scherer
Jürgen Beyerer
机构
[1] Fraunhofer Institute of Optronics,Intelligent Sensor
[2] System Technologies and Image Exploitation IOSB,Actuator
[3] Karlsruhe Institute of Technology (KIT),Systems Laboratory (ISAS)
[4] Ruhr-Universität Bochum (RUB),Department of Energy Plant Technology (LEAT)
[5] TU Berlin,Mechanical Process Engineering and Solids Processing
来源
Journal of Real-Time Image Processing | 2019年 / 16卷
关键词
Linear assignment problem; Sensor-based sorting; Parallel algorithm; Graphics processing unit;
D O I
暂无
中图分类号
学科分类号
摘要
Utilizing parallel algorithms is an established way of increasing performance in systems that are bound to real-time restrictions. Sensor-based sorting is a machine vision application for which firm real-time requirements need to be respected in order to reliably remove potentially harmful entities from a material feed. Recently, employing a predictive tracking approach using multitarget tracking in order to decrease the error in the physical separation in optical sorting has been proposed. For implementations that use hard associations between measurements and tracks, a linear assignment problem has to be solved for each frame recorded by a camera. The auction algorithm can be utilized for this purpose, which also has the advantage of being well suited for parallel architectures. In this paper, an improved implementation of this algorithm for a graphics processing unit (GPU) is presented. The resulting algorithm is implemented in both an OpenCL and a CUDA based environment. By using an optimized data structure, the presented algorithm outperforms recently proposed implementations in terms of speed while retaining the quality of output of the algorithm. Furthermore, memory requirements are significantly decreased, which is important for embedded systems. Experimental results are provided for two different GPUs and six datasets. It is shown that the proposed approach is of particular interest for applications dealing with comparatively large problem sizes.
引用
收藏
页码:2261 / 2272
页数:11
相关论文
共 50 条
  • [31] A real-time GNSS-R system based on software-defined radio and graphics processing units
    Hobiger, Thomas
    Amagai, Jun
    Aida, Masanori
    Narita, Hideki
    ADVANCES IN SPACE RESEARCH, 2012, 49 (07) : 1180 - 1190
  • [32] Modular sensor-based respirometer for real-time monitoring of respiration rate
    Keshri, N.
    Truppel, I
    Herppich, W. B.
    Geyer, M.
    Mahajan, P., V
    VI INTERNATIONAL SYMPOSIUM ON APPLICATIONS OF MODELLING AS AN INNOVATIVE TECHNOLOGY IN THE HORTICULTURAL SUPPLY CHAIN MODEL-IT 2019, 2021, 1311 : 297 - 302
  • [33] Reliability of sensor-based real-time workflow recognition in laparoscopic cholecystectomy
    Michael Kranzfelder
    Armin Schneider
    Adam Fiolka
    Sebastian Koller
    Silvano Reiser
    Thomas Vogel
    Dirk Wilhelm
    Hubertus Feussner
    International Journal of Computer Assisted Radiology and Surgery, 2014, 9 : 941 - 948
  • [34] Real-time risk monitoring in business processes: A sensor-based approach
    Conforti, Raffaele
    La Rosa, Marcello
    Fortino, Giancarlo
    ter Hofstede, Arthur H. M.
    Recker, Jan
    Adams, Michael
    JOURNAL OF SYSTEMS AND SOFTWARE, 2013, 86 (11) : 2939 - 2965
  • [35] Complete real-time path planning during sensor-based discovery
    Zelek, JS
    1998 IEEE/RSJ INTERNATIONAL CONFERENCE ON INTELLIGENT ROBOTS AND SYSTEMS - PROCEEDINGS, VOLS 1-3: INNOVATIONS IN THEORY, PRACTICE AND APPLICATIONS, 1998, : 1399 - 1404
  • [36] Wearable Sensor-Based Real-Time Gait Detection: A Systematic Review
    Prasanth, Hari
    Caban, Miroslav
    Keller, Urs
    Courtine, Gregoire
    Ijspeert, Auke
    Vallery, Heike
    von Zitzewitz, Joachim
    SENSORS, 2021, 21 (08)
  • [37] SROS: Sensor-based Real-time Observing System for Ecological Research
    Cheng, Jie
    Zhou, Yuanchun
    Wang, Binglin
    Wang, Xuezhi
    Li, Jianhui
    WISM: 2009 INTERNATIONAL CONFERENCE ON WEB INFORMATION SYSTEMS AND MINING, PROCEEDINGS, 2009, : 396 - 400
  • [38] Reliability of sensor-based real-time workflow recognition in laparoscopic cholecystectomy
    Kranzfelder, Michael
    Schneider, Armin
    Fiolka, Adam
    Koller, Sebastian
    Reiser, Silvano
    Vogel, Thomas
    Wilhelm, Dirk
    Feussner, Hubertus
    INTERNATIONAL JOURNAL OF COMPUTER ASSISTED RADIOLOGY AND SURGERY, 2014, 9 (06) : 941 - 948
  • [39] NEW LANGUAGE STRUCTURE FOR SENSOR-BASED ACTIONS TO DESCRIBE THE REAL-TIME BEHAVIOR OF AUTONOMOUS ROBOTS
    HABIB, MK
    SUZUKI, S
    YUTA, SI
    IIJIMA, JI
    INTERNATIONAL JOURNAL OF ELECTRONICS, 1991, 70 (04) : 653 - 670
  • [40] Real-time implementation of fast discriminative scale space tracking algorithm
    Walid Walid
    Muhammad Awais
    Ashfaq Ahmed
    Guido Masera
    Maurizio Martina
    Journal of Real-Time Image Processing, 2021, 18 : 2347 - 2360